Troubleshooting HP Brightness Keys: The Hunt for Sp65563.exe

If you own an older HP laptop and find that your brightness hotkeys (typically Fn + F9/F10

) have suddenly stopped working, you aren't alone. Many users specifically search for a file named Sp65563.exe to solve this frustrating issue. What is Sp65563.exe? Sp65563.exe is a legacy HP HotKey Support

driver package. Its primary job is to enable the special function keys on HP notebooks, allowing users to control hardware features like screen brightness, volume, and wireless toggles directly from the keyboard. Why is it Hard to Find?

HP regularly updates its driver database, often archiving older "SoftPaq" (sp) files in favor of newer versions like the HP System Event Utility

. Because Sp65563.exe is an older version, it is frequently unavailable on official support pages, leading users to seek it out on community forums. Common Fixes for Broken Hotkeys

Before hunting for a specific archived .exe file, try these standard troubleshooting steps often recommended by HP Support Community Update Graphics Drivers

: In many cases, brightness control is tied to the graphics driver rather than just the keyboard. Ensure your Intel or AMD graphics drivers are fully installed and updated. Install HP System Event Utility

: For newer models (post-2015), this utility has replaced the older HotKey Support drivers. Check the Keyboard Filter

: If you see an "unspecified device" or "Keyboard_Filter_01" in your Device Manager, it usually indicates a missing hotkey or utility driver. Bios Settings

: Occasionally, "Action Keys Mode" may be disabled in the BIOS, requiring you to hold the key to use the brightness functions. Safety Warning When searching for specific files like Sp65563.exe outside of HP's official site

, exercise caution. Download drivers only from reputable mirrors to avoid malware. File Identification Report: sp65563.exe OverviewThe file sp65563.exe is a legitimate SoftPaq executable provided by Hewlett-Packard (HP). It is primarily used to install or update the HP Hotkey Support driver, which enables the functionality of special function (Fn) keys on HP notebook computers. 1. Technical Details Developer: Hewlett-Packard (HP) Driver Name: HP Hotkey Support Version: 7.0.12.1 Release Date: February 03, 2014 File Size: 23.12 MB

Hardware Compatibility: Commonly associated with business-class notebooks such as the HP ProBook 2570p and HP ProBook 450 G2.

Supported Operating Systems: Windows XP, Vista, 7, 8, 10, and 11 (both 32-bit and 64-bit architectures). 2. Primary Functionality

This software package allows the operating system to recognize and respond to specialized keys on the keyboard. Key features include:

Brightness Control: Resolves issues where the brightness slider is missing or Fn keys for brightness do not respond.

Quick Launch Buttons: Configures shortcuts for various system tasks directly from the keyboard.

Volume and Media Controls: Ensures standard media playback hotkeys function correctly. 3. Known Issues and Recommendations

Official Availability: Some users have reported that this specific driver version is occasionally difficult to find on the Official HP® Drivers and Software Download portal.

Alternative Support: For newer systems or persistent issues, HP recommends using the HP Support Assistant to automatically identify and install the correct driver package.

Troubleshooting: If the Fn buttons stop working after a Windows update, users have successfully resolved the issue by disabling the "HP Hotkey UWP Service" in Windows Services or updating to a newer SoftPaq like sp91903.exe. 4. Safety and Verification

While sp65563.exe is a legitimate HP file, always ensure you are downloading from a trusted source. You can verify driver details or find archived versions through third-party repositories like DriverIdentifier if the official HP site is unavailable.
